In 2024, the San Francisco 49ers and the Kansas City Chiefs will play in the Super Bowl. On Sunday, February 11, the biggest football match in the United States will take place at Allegiant Stadium in Las Vegas. However, there will be other players outside NFL players.
At the Super Bowl Halftime Show, who will be performing?
The “Superstar” of Sunday’s Super Bowl 58 halftime performance will be Usher. The eight-time Grammy winner was chosen in September to open the Apple Music-sponsored halftime show at Allegiant Stadium in Las Vegas. He referred to the performance as “an honour of a lifetime.” After concluding a fully booked 100-show engagement in Sin City in December, Usher recently referred to Las Vegas as his “new home. The Super Bowl Halftime Show takes place when?
The halftime concert featuring Usher will happen, well, during halftime, but when is that? The brief break that occurs between the first and second halves of the Super Bowl is known as halftime. Two 15-minute quarters make up each half of the game; however, the game clock is not the same as the actual duration of the game. It’s difficult to estimate when halftime will arrive due to play-stoppages like as timeouts, TV timeouts, and advertisements during the game; nonetheless, each quarter usually lasts for around 45 minutes.
The Halftime Show lasts for how long?
Super Bowl halftime runs longer than the typical NFL halftime of 13 minutes to provide for the teams’ on-field warm-ups as well as setup, show, and teardown. Even so, Usher won’t be performing for more than fifteen minutes onstage. During the halftime concert in November, Usher warned, “Don’t take the moments for granted because you only get 13 of them.” “Squeezing everything in when you truly have a vast library or a lot of recordings people celebrate and adore is the hardest part.
The National Anthem is being sung by whom?
During the pregame, 68-year-old Reba McEntire, dubbed “The Queen of Country Music,” will perform the national anthem. Bettors will set their stopwatches to time Reba McEntire’s performance when she takes the stage on Sunday to play the national anthem. This is not a novel concept. For as long as there have been offshore unlicensed gambling sites, casual gamblers have enjoyed a pastime of wagering on how long the national anthem will last. Consequently, a while. The betting line for this year is between 86 and 90.5 seconds. With the average length of an anthem performance being one minute and five seconds, it makes sense to favour the “over.”
Usher will headline the 2024 Super Bowl halftime show in Las Vegas
LOS ANGELES The Grammy winner Usher has revealed that he will be the main attraction at the Apple Music Super Bowl Halftime Show in Las Vegas. Sunday, the NFL, Apple Music, and Roc Nation revealed that Usher would host the halftime show on February 11 at Allegiant Stadium.
The eight-time Grammy winner expressed his excitement about taking the stage at the NFL’s largest event. Usher stated in a statement, “It’s an honour of a lifetime to finally cross off a Super Bowl performance on my bucket list.” “I’m excited to provide a show to the globe that is unlike anything they have ever seen from me.”
With “Confessions,” which has sold over 10 million copies in the United States and garnered eight nominations and three wins at the 2005 Grammy Awards, Usher launched himself into fame. Two months after the legend’s passing, Ray Charles’s farewell record “Genius Loves Company” won album of the year, defeating him.
One of the best-selling music albums of all time, “Confessions” gave rise to several No. 1 songs, including “Yeah!” with Ludacris and Lil Jon, “Burn,” and “Confessions Part II.” The Alicia Keys duet “My Boo,” a mellow success, was added in his special edition version. The monumental record will celebrate its 20th anniversary next year.
With sold-out gigs and fantastic reviews, Usher, 44, is presently headlining his “Usher: My Way” residency in Las Vegas. On Sunday, he will also kick off an eight-night run of shows in Paris. Usher is scheduled to conclude his residency in Las Vegas in early December, following which he will perform during the Super Bowl a few months later.

I’m eager to witness the enchantment. The halftime show’s co-executive producers will be Roc Nation and Emmy-winning producer Jesse Collins. Director Hamish Hamilton is back.
This is the NFL, Apple Music, and Roc Nation’s second partnership. For a spectacular halftime act last year, a pregnant Rihanna appeared dangling on a platform above the field. It was her first solo engagement in seven years.
